Harrison Edwards was tasked in late 2016 with launching the biggest infrastructure announcement to hit Westchester County, New York in a generation. Gigabit Westchester is a public-private smart growth initiative to bring gigabit-speed broadband to every premises in Westchester's four major cities: Mt. Vernon, New Rochelle, White Plains, and Yonkers. 

The announcement made national headlines and created a seismic shift in the New York marketplace in how the telecommunications industry delivers service. As the project forges ahead, Harrison Edwards leverages its contacts to bring some of the nation's top minds aboard from IBM Smarter Cities, the Federal Reserve Bank, and the Brookings Institution.
